Thermal Fill Operator - Evening Shift  Position Overview The Thermal Fill Operator performs repetitive extrusion modification operations to produce quality window and door stock rail products. This position will inspect material for quality defects, feed parts into a machine & operate specialized equipment that fills stock lengths of material with thermal break. The thermal fill helps eliminate the transfer of heat to make windows more energy efficient. Duties and ResponsibilitiesUnderstand the daily production goals, on-time complete is a critical numberRead and decipher paperwork to ensure proper specifications are met for each job Inspect material for any quality defectsTape applicable rails prior to fillingFeed parts into Thermo-Fill Equipment in specified relationship to the fill nozzle, rollers and or saw bladeSafely operate the Thermal-Fill machineMonitor adequate fill being careful not to overfillVerify cut depth and width is within acceptable parametersStack rails according to their typeOperate the De-bridge sawDouble check paint coverageUnload material and fill carts as laid out in the Pick OrderProperly clean equipmentTimely report any maintenance issuesFill in at different workstations as production needs require.Prompt and regular attendance at an assigned work location.Interact and communicate with employees and customers in an appropriate manner.Availability on site to confer with staff members with whom the employee must interact on a regular basis.Complete assigned tasks in a timely manner.  Supervisory ResponsibilityNo direct management or supervisory responsibilities. SafetyObserve safety and security policies and procedures, including proper use of Personal Protective Equipment including but not limited to eye and toe protection.
